The 35th anniversary of the Telugu crime-action movie Shiva, which stars Nagarjuna, has been marked in Indian film. The movie came out on October 5, 1989, and was directed by Ram Gopal Varma. Shiva is Varma’s first movie as a director. It was produced by Akkineni Venkat and Yarlagadda Surendra under the names of Annapurna Studios and SS Creations. After that, the movie was made again in Hindi in 1990.

In honor of the 35th anniversary, Ram Gopal Varma sent his best wishes to everyone who worked on the movie. He wrote on X, “Today, October 5, marks the 35th anniversary of my adventure with @iamnagarjuna.”Happy birthday to everyone who helped make it.

Nagarjuna also remembers the times he talked with his dad and the famous star Akkineni Nageshwar Rao. “It’s been 35 years and one day since the famous #shiva came out!! “I will never forget that day when my dad, Anr garu, and I were driving in the car and he said, “I saw Shiva last night and heard it’s a big hit this morning. But I think it will become one of the biggest hits in Telugu film history!!” He wrote on X.

“Nana, your words were so very true. Thank you for all the love you still have for Shiva after all these years! It was possible because of many people, especially @RGVzoomin, he said.

RGV replied to his post and thanked him for being his first break. “Thank you for giving me the BEST BREAK OF MY LIFE.””There would have been no Shiva or me without your unwavering support and trust in me,” he wrote.

The movie also has Amala, Raghuvaran, Viswanath, and Tanikella Bharani in it. The movie was shot by S. Gopala Reddy, and it was edited by Sattibabu. The movie’s music was written by Ilaiyaraaja. Ram Gopal Varma wrote the story and the script, and Tanikella Bharani wrote the lines. Shiva also won a number of awards, such as the Filmfare Award for Best Telugu Film, the Nandi Award for Best Director (Varma), the Nandi Award for Best First Film of a Director, and the Nandi Award for Best Dialogue Writer (Bharani).
